During this 4 months residency at the Ron Andrews Community Centre in North Vancouver, we focused on felting fungi that were be found in the forested woods of Windridge Park, next to the community centre, to create a series of felted books inspired by local fungi species, and using simple wet felting and needle felting methods. Each book was collectively felted by over 50 community members of all ages in collaboration with artists Isabelle Kirouac and Willoughby Arévalo. To imbue this project with experiential learning and interdisciplinary arts inspired by fungi, we will also offered mushroom walks, a movement practice and sensorial activities inspired by fungi.

















From February to August 2025, the felted books will be exhibited in the Ron Andrews community center lobby for the public to consult and enjoy. This Project has been supported by North Vancouver Culture & Recreation Artist Residency program.
